JUSTICE ASHUTOSH KUMAR ORAL ORDER 24-07-2021 Heard Mr. Arun Kumar, the learned Advocate for the petitioner, Mr. Ranjan Kumar Jha, the learned Advocate for the informant and Mr. Surendra Prasad Singh, the learned APP for the State.

The petitioner seeks bail in anticipation of his arrest in connection with Bhagalpur Mahila P. S. Case No.64 of 2018, instituted for the offences under Section 498(A), 354A and 34 of the Indian Penal Code and Section 3⁄4 of the D. P. Act. At the outset, the learned Advocate for the petitioner has submitted that he is not averse to the talks of settlement with his wife/ opposite party no.2, provided she is agreeable for the same. He also wants a rapprochement and perhaps restitution of conjugal rights.

No.41123 of 2020(2) dt.24-07-2021 2/2 Considering the aforesaid stand of the petitioner, this Court directs that if he surrenders before the Court below within a period of eight weeks from today, he shall be released on provisional bail. While granting provisional bail to the petitioner, his wife (opposite party no.2) shall be noticed and on her appearance, the Court below shall explore the possibilities of settlement between the spouses. In case, the settlement is arrived at, the Court below shall fix the modality of the return of opposite party no.2/ wife to her matrimonial home. The provisional bail of the petitioner shall be confirmed only on settlement of dispute between the parties or in the event of the opposite party no. 2/ wife deliberately choosing not to settle the dispute without any appropriate cause. If the conduct of the petitioner is found to be genuine, his provisional bail shall be confirmed by the Court below.

With the aforesaid observation/ direction, the application stands disposed off.
